Solar energy is energy from the sun that we capture with various technologies, including solar panels. There are two main types of solar energy: photovoltaic (solar panels) and thermal.
Solar energy is generated by converting sunlight into usable electricity through the use of solar panels. These panels are made up of photovoltaic (PV) cells, which capture and convert the sun''s rays into a direct current (DC) electrical flow.

Unlike fossil fuels, which are finite and depleted, solar energy does not diminish with use. Every day, the sun provides the Earth with more energy than humanity could use in thousands of years at current consumption rates.
Renewable energy sources, such as solar and wind power, have seen significant cost reductions over the past decade, making them more competitive with traditional fossil fuels. [5] In some geographic localities, photovoltaic solar or onshore wind are the cheapest new-build electricity. [6]
